Title: How to remove nagware?
Post by: scottlindner on April 30, 2009, 03:34:04 pm
Does anyone know how to permanently remove the nagware screen on MC12 that reminds me every time I start the app that I can pay more money than I already have?
Title: Re: How to remove nagware?
Post by: DarkPenguin on April 30, 2009, 04:08:01 pm
If you are referring to the check for updates screen you might consider unchecking that option under Startup.
